Steady Blog
2. 함수 정리 본문
*함수 정리*
fflush(stdin) : 키보드 버퍼를 없애는 명령어
cin.get( 변수명, 배열갯수(ex:5) ) : 문자열을 입력받는 함수로서 공백문자도 받을 수 있음.
cin.ignore() : 키보드 버퍼로 부터 문자 1개를 지우는 함수
cin.getline( 변수명, 배열갯수(ex:5) ) : cin.get()+cin.ignore()
strlwr( 배열명 ) : 문자열을 모수 소문자로 만드는 함수
getch() : 문자 1개 입력받는 함수 ,단! 문자는 보이지 않는다. 그래서 기능적으로 일시 멈춤으로 사용 한다.
system("cls"); // 화면을 깨끗하게 지우는 함수.
system("pause");// 임시 멈춤
setw() : 왼쪽으로 출력하라.
setiosflags(ios::left); //왼쪽으로 붙이기.
srand(time(NULL)); //srand() = rand() 초기화 함수.
(rand() % ('Z'-'A'+1)) + 'A'; //rand() = 난수 함수 즉 임의의 숫자를 만드는 함수
// 유용한 식. A~Z범위 안의 난수 생성. - 이것은 Z~A사이의 값을 랜덤하게 뽑는것.
strlen(변수명) +1 : 변수의 입력글자 수 표현
'Programing > C++' 카테고리의 다른 글
6. 함수의 Default (0) | 2012.09.03 |
---|---|
5. 함수의 오버로딩 (0) | 2012.09.03 |
4. 함수호출 / C언어와 C++의 함수 호출 차이 (0) | 2012.09.03 |
3. 함수정의 / 임시 변수 / return의 기능 (0) | 2012.09.03 |
1. 해더 파일 정리 (0) | 2012.09.03 |